Home-learning overview.
We recognise that our students work really hard in school and that their time away from school should be spent with family and friends. We also think that in order to support their learning in school, a measured approach to home-learning is necessary. We’ve thought carefully about this balance.
How will it work?
All students will have a home-learning book. At the front of the book will be space to put their usernames and passwords for the various online programs we have on offer. KS3 Students will also be given an overview sheet of home-learning for the foundation subjects for the term. These will be posted on our website.
Years 5&6
In years 5&6, student will have home-learning that supports their lessons in English, Maths and Science. Tasks will be given to them and they will be instructed to complete them in their home-learning book or on the sheets provided.
English and Maths home-learning will be given weekly. Science will be given at appropriate intervals to support learning back in school. We also expect students to be reading at home for 15 minutes each day.
Years 7&8
In years 7&8, student will have home-learning that supports their lessons in English, Maths and Science. They will also be given one piece of home learning per term for all other subjects. Tasks will be given to them and they will be instructed to complete them in their home-learning book, on the sheets provided or in another format that will be clearly stated.
English and Maths home-learning will be given weekly. Science will be given at appropriate intervals to support learning back in school. We also expect students to be reading at home for 20 minutes each day.
Working together
We hope you’ll support your child in completing home-learning to a high standard and in turn we will be providing a home-learning club back in school. Students who complete their home-learning will be rewarded through house points which they’ll be able to spend at the school shop! We’re also very keen to hear parental feedback and at the end of the term, I’ll be sending out a questionnaire to gauge the success of the home learning approach and make any necessary improvements.
